#9E9EEB Color
#9E9EEB is rgb(158, 158, 235) in RGB, hsl(240, 66%, 77%) in HSL, and about cmyk(33%, 33%, 0%, 8%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Perano (Infinitely Hot) (#94B1FF), visibly different at ΔE 10.54.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

#9E9EEB Channel Values
How #9E9EEB bre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 158 · G 158 · B 235 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 240° · S 66% · L 77%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 240° · S 33% · V 92%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 33% · M 33% · Y 0% · K 8%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 2.46:1 vs white · 8.54: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|
Text Contrast & Accessibility
W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#9E9EEB background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

#9E9EEB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#9E9EEB?
#9E9EEB is a light blue — rgb(158, 158, 235) in RGB and hsl(240, 66%, 77%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Perano (Infinitely Hot) (#94B1FF), which is visibly different at a CIE76 distance of 10.54.
What is the RGB value of #9E9EEB?
#9E9EEB is rgb(158, 158, 235) — red 158, green 158, and blue 235 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#9E9EEB?
#9E9EEB converts to approximately cmyk(33%, 33%, 0%, 8%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#9E9EEB be black or white?
Black text is the more readable choice. #9E9EEB scores 2.46:1 against white and 8.54: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#9E9EEB as a CSS color keyword?
No. #9E9EEB is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is cornflowerblue (#6495ED) at a CIE76 distance of 16.31, which is visibly different.
